A Guide to Professional Glass Replacement for Broken Windows in Your Home

Posted on

Accidents happen, and one of the unfortunate outcomes can be a broken window in your home. Whether it's due to severe weather, a stray baseball, or a simple mishap, a broken window can disrupt the comfort and security of your living space. In situations like these, it is crucial to seek professional glass replacement services to restore the integrity and functionality of your windows. This post will guide you through the process of professional residential glass replacement.

Assessment and Measurements

The first step in the glass replacement process is to assess the damage and take accurate measurements. It is important to determine the size, type, and thickness of the glass needed for the replacement. A professional glass technician will carefully evaluate the broken window and ensure that the replacement glass matches the specifications required for your specific window frame.

Glass Removal and Cleanup

Once the assessment is complete, the next step is to remove the broken glass from the window frame. This is a delicate and potentially hazardous task that requires expertise and proper safety precautions. A professional technician will take care to remove all broken glass shards and clean the area to ensure it is safe and ready for the new glass installation.

Glass Fabrication and Customization

Once the measurements have been taken and the broken glass has been removed, the next step is to fabricate and customize the replacement glass. This process involves precise cutting and shaping to match the exact dimensions and specifications of your window. Professional glass replacement services have access to state-of-the-art equipment and a wide range of glass options, ensuring a perfect fit for your window.

Installation and Sealing

With the custom replacement glass prepared, it's time to install it securely into the window frame. The technician will use specialized techniques and materials to ensure a secure fit and seal, preventing air leakage and providing insulation. Proper sealing also contributes to the overall energy efficiency of your home.

Final Inspection and Cleanup

After installation, a final inspection will be conducted to ensure the replacement glass is in perfect condition. The technician will check for proper alignment, functionality, and aesthetics. Any excess debris or residues from the installation process will be removed, leaving your home clean and tidy.
